logo

IPv6过渡利器:Tunnel Broker技术详解与实践指南

作者:十万个为什么2026.02.07 07:41浏览量:1

简介:本文深度解析Tunnel Broker技术原理,详述其通过IPv4网络实现IPv6数据传输的核心机制,对比不同隧道配置模式的特点与适用场景。通过系统化梳理技术架构、配置流程及典型应用场景,帮助网络管理员和开发者快速掌握这一关键过渡技术,有效解决IPv4向IPv6迁移过程中的网络连通性问题。

一、技术演进背景与核心价值

在IPv4地址资源枯竭与IPv6部署加速的双重驱动下,网络过渡技术成为关键基础设施。Tunnel Broker作为主流解决方案之一,通过构建虚拟隧道实现两种协议的兼容互通,其核心价值体现在三个方面:

  1. 资源复用:利用现有IPv4网络承载IPv6流量,避免重复建设
  2. 灵活接入:支持单机、小型站点等多种接入形态
  3. 管理可控:提供集中化的隧道配置与策略管理接口

相较于6to4等自发式隧道机制,Tunnel Broker通过中心化控制平面实现更精细的流量调度和安全管控,特别适合运营商网络环境下的标准化部署。某研究机构测试数据显示,采用该技术可使IPv6部署周期缩短60%,配置错误率降低75%。

二、系统架构与组件解析

典型实现包含三大核心组件:

  1. Tunnel Broker服务端

    • 隧道生命周期管理:创建/修改/删除隧道配置
    • 地址分配:动态分配/24到/48的IPv6前缀
    • 策略引擎:支持ISP自定义路由策略
  2. Tunnel Server转发节点

    • 封装/解封装处理:实现IPv6-in-IPv4数据转换
    • 路由优化:支持6in4、6to4、AYIYA等多种封装协议
    • 流量监控:实时统计隧道利用率和错误率
  3. 客户端组件

    • 自动配置工具:支持主流操作系统(Linux/Windows/macOS)
    • 心跳检测:维持隧道活跃状态
    • 故障转移:支持主备隧道自动切换

架构示意图:

  1. [Client] <--> [IPv4 Network] <--> [Tunnel Server]
  2. ^ |
  3. |----------------------------------|
  4. [Tunnel Broker DB]

三、隧道配置模式深度对比

3.1 静态配置隧道(Configured Tunnel)

适用场景:企业专线、数据中心互联等稳定连接场景

配置要点

  1. 需预先获取全球单播IPv6地址块
  2. 隧道两端需配置固定IPv4端点地址
  3. 示例配置(Linux):
    1. ip tunnel add tun6to4 mode sit remote 192.0.2.1 local 198.51.100.2
    2. ip addr add 2001:db8::2/64 dev tun6to4
    3. ip link set tun6to4 up
    4. ip route add ::/0 dev tun6to4

优势

  • 确定性路由路径
  • 最低传输时延
  • 支持QoS标记传递

局限

  • 配置复杂度高(需操作20+参数)
  • NAT穿越能力弱
  • 缺乏弹性扩展能力

3.2 动态配置隧道(Auto-configured Tunnel)

适用场景:移动终端、家庭宽带等动态IP环境

实现机制

  1. 基于Protocol 41的自动发现
  2. 端点地址通过DNS或ANYCAST解析
  3. 典型流程:
    1. Client DNS查询 获取TS地址 建立隧道 地址协商

技术特性

  • 支持NAT-T(NAT Traversal)扩展
  • 心跳间隔可配置(默认300秒)
  • 隧道保持时间动态调整

性能数据

  • 建链延迟:<500ms(跨运营商场景)
  • 最大吞吐量:受限于IPv4基础网络(通常100Mbps-1Gbps)
  • 丢包率:<0.1%(优质网络环境)

四、典型部署方案与最佳实践

4.1 企业级部署架构

  1. [Branch Office] --[IPv4 VPN]-- [HQ Tunnel Broker] --[IPv6 Core]-- [Cloud Services]

实施要点

  1. 分层设计:区域TS聚合流量至核心TB
  2. 高可用配置:
    • TS集群部署(至少3节点)
    • 数据库主从同步
    • 配置热备份机制
  3. 安全加固
    • 隧道端点认证(IPsec/PSK)
    • 流量过滤(基于IPv6源地址)
    • 日志审计(保留90天记录)

4.2 运维监控体系

建议构建包含以下要素的监控系统:

  1. 指标采集

    • 隧道活跃数/新建速率
    • 封装/解封装错误率
    • 平均建链时间
  2. 告警规则

    1. IF tunnel_error_rate > 5% FOR 5min THEN ALERT
    2. IF new_tunnel_count > 100/min THEN THROTTLE
  3. 可视化看板

    • 实时拓扑图(显示隧道健康状态)
    • 历史趋势分析(流量/错误率)
    • 地理分布热图(客户端位置)

五、技术演进趋势与挑战

当前发展呈现三大方向:

  1. 协议扩展

    • 支持DS-Lite等双栈轻量化方案
    • 集成MPLS封装能力
  2. 自动化升级

    • 基于NETCONF的配置管理
    • 与SDN控制器集成
  3. 安全增强

    • 隧道级DDoS防护
    • 端到端加密(可选IPsec叠加)

面临的主要挑战包括:

  • IPv4碎片化导致的路径MTU问题
  • 移动场景下的频繁重连开销
  • 多运营商环境下的路由优化

六、选型建议与实施路线图

评估维度
| 指标 | 企业级方案 | 开源方案 |
|——————————-|—————————|—————————|
| 隧道容量 | 10K+ | 1K-5K |
| 管理接口 | RESTful API | CLI/SNMP |
| 扩展能力 | 横向扩展 | 垂直扩展 |
| 运维工具 | 完整套件 | 需自行集成 |

实施阶段

  1. 试点期(1-3月):选择非核心业务验证技术可行性
  2. 推广期(3-6月):建立标准化配置模板
  3. 优化期(6-12月):完善监控告警体系

通过系统化的技术选型与渐进式实施策略,可有效控制迁移风险,实现IPv6网络的平滑过渡。当前主流云服务商均已提供兼容性解决方案,建议结合具体业务场景选择最适合的部署模式。

相关文章推荐

发表评论

活动